Skip to main content
Woohoo! Qlik Community has won “Best in Class Community” in the 2024 Khoros Kudos awards!
Announcements
Nov. 20th, Qlik Insider - Lakehouses: Driving the Future of Data & AI - PICK A SESSION
cancel
Showing results for 
Search instead for 
Did you mean: 
Not applicable

Função de exibição de imagem dentro de uma tabela

Olá,

Gostaria de saber qual função utilizo para exibir uma imagem apos ter selecionado algum item de uma lista ou tabela???

tks!!

Labels (2)
10 Replies
Not applicable
Author

Tiago,

Quando vc quer carregar uma figura usa o prefixo INFO antes do load, o primeiro campo exibe a descrição, no exemplo abaixo nome do banco, e o outro campo contém o endereço para a figura em si:



Logos:
INFO
LOAD
Banco,
Logo
FROM XPTO.txt (ansi, txt, delimiter is ',', embedded labels, msq);




Ai no objeto, se for uma expressão por exemplo, vc deve informar que trata-se de uma figura, na propriedade Representação, e usa uma a função info como no exemplo abaixo:

Info(Banco)

A figura será exibida conforme o banco selecionado.



Nesse caso, vc é obrigado a manter as figuras em uma pasta para onde o caminho aponta (campo Logo). Mas é possível também carregar essa figura para dentro do QVW acrescentando a prefixo BUNDLE antes de info:



Logos:
BUNDLE
INFO
LOAD
Banco,
Logo
FROM XPTO.txt (ansi, txt, delimiter is ',', embedded labels, msq);


Lembrando que nesse caso, o QVW ocupará mais memória RAM, então dependendo do que for carregar, tamanho da figura, não é aconselhável usar o BUNDLE.

Not applicable
Author

Obrigado Fabio pela ajuda...mas complementando minha duvida é o seguinte preciso saber como eu faco para exibir essa imagem quando eu selecionar algum item especifico de uma lista/tabela, ex: minha tabela tem os meses do ano, quando eu selecionar algum mês quero que seja exibido a imagem...

essa selecao tambem pode ser feita atraves de objeo calendario????

obrigado por enquanto

TiagoNC

Not applicable
Author

Not applicable
Author

Obrigado mais uma vez....mas acho q nao me expressei bem....bom eu preciso saber como faço para que quando eu clicar em algum objeto em uma lista/tabela apareca em uma nova janela a imagem como se dentro da tabela existisse um link, assim como quando vc cria um botao e insere um link para abrir uma 'pasta"

obrigado!!!

Not applicable
Author

Bom Dia,

Neste caso tente utilizar a opção para esconder/mostrar determinado objeto.

Na aba Layout, na opção "SHOW" marque a opção Conditional e determine qual a condição que este objeto seja mostrado ou não.

No seu caso acredito que deva verificar se o valor de algum campo de uma tabela esteja selecionado ou não.

Abraços!

michaelataides
Contributor III
Contributor III

Bom dia,

Poderias dar um exemplo de código, pois na verdade eu estou tentando verificara se o campo foi selecionado e não um valor do campo.

lucianosv
Specialist
Specialist

Segue exemplo.

Veja se ajuda.

Not applicable
Author

eu fiz esse teste q vc passou mas não funcionou aqui .....Será q indicando o caminho de alguma forma funcionaria??

Estarei testando , achei bem interessante a dúvida .....

lucianosv
Specialist
Specialist

Bom dia.

Neste qvw, as imagens que enviei estão na mesma pasta do qvw. Dessa forma funciona.